Description
Cs3I crystallizes in the hexagonal P6_3/mmc space group. The structure is one-dimensional and consists of two Cs3I ribbons oriented in the (0, 0, 1) direction. Cs is bonded in an L-shaped geometry to two equivalent I atoms. Both Cs–I bond lengths are 3.94 Å. I is bonded to six equivalent Cs atoms to form distorted face-sharing ICs6 pentagonal pyramids.
